Pour some margarita salt or sugar onto a shallow plate. Run a lime wedge along the rim of your glasses and dip it into the margarita salt or sugar. Set aside.
Add grapefruit juice, tequila, lime juice, simple syrup, and ice to a blender.
Blend for about 30 seconds or until the mixture is smooth and there are no more ice chunks. Pour into the prepared glasses and garnish with a grapefruit slice. Enjoy!

Variations & Substitutions
Skip the Blender: For a traditional Paloma, mix 2 ounces tequila, 2 ounces fresh grapefruit juice, 2 ounces sparkling water, ½ ounce lime juice, and ¼ ounce simple syrup or agave nectar; stir to combine and pour into a salt or sugar-rimmed highball or margarita glass. Add ice to fill the glass and enjoy!
Replace simple syrup with honey or agave instead if preferred.
Garnish with a sprig of basil or rosemary for an herbaceous drink.
Make it Sweeter: If the bitter grapefruit and tart lime are a little too strong for your taste, you can add liquid cane sugar to sweeten it up.
Make it Spicy: Add a dash of hot sauce or jalapeno pepper juice, or rim the glass with a little Tajin or chili powder for a pleasant kick.
Make it Smoky: Use Mezcal instead of tequila.
Additional Fruity Flavor: If you feel like something is missing, consider adding another fruit juice, like papaya or pomegranate, or a dash of homemade blueberry or cranberry simple syrup. Or use half grapefruit juice and half blood orange juice.
Need Bubbles? Stir in some grapefruit mixer or other bubbly mixers, such as Club soda, Tonic water, or your favorite grapefruit soda.
